Information of the Vendor Clause Samples

The 'Information of the Vendor' clause requires the vendor to provide specific details about their identity, business status, and relevant qualifications or certifications. Typically, this clause outlines the types of information the vendor must disclose, such as company registration numbers, contact information, and any licenses necessary to perform the contracted services. By mandating the disclosure of this information, the clause ensures transparency and allows the buyer to verify the vendor's legitimacy and suitability for the transaction.
